That’s data science. Data science is about the extraction of knowledge from the noise – acquiring meaningful and actionable insights from raw data. Data science can empower better business decisions.

The revolution will now be analyzed.

By applying artificial intelligence and machine learning, Lumen analyzes data to predict system and application outages or anomalies even before they happen. Our teams use this knowledge to create an algorithm – or a set of instructions – to remedy the problem or start an alert process.

Our teams at Lumen use data science to revolutionize experiences. Our customers see improved results. Employees can now do more with less frustration and more satisfaction.

Intelligent data insights can be used to quickly identify potential issues like card failures that could lead to a network outage, application disruptions, or customer modems not performing correctly. By proactively identifying at-risk systems and applications, we can set in motion actions to resolve issues before a customer even notices an impact. This ultimately can help save our customers money, increase overall retention, and reduce process cycle times.

Lumen has done some cool things using data science over the past year.

  • Predicted and resolved more than 25 potential network outages.
  • Identified and applied remote fixes to customer modems eliminating the need for a repair dispatch.
  • Used natural language processing (NLP) to enhance our chat capabilities to ensure better customer experiences.
  • Conducted ongoing monitoring of internal IT applications to ensure optimal performance.
  • Automated employee access to critical applications.
  • Created a crowd-sourcing platform that fosters sharing of insights and approaches to solving business problems with data science.

Lance leads the Data Science Innovations team consisting of Lumen’s AI Center of Excellence, RPA Center of Excellence and Blockchain work. He and his team have applied data science in a number of business functions such as reducing defects in a manufacturing plant, identifying early warning signs for employee turnover and improving margin attainment in a call center. These same principles are being applied in IT to prevent outages, reduce customer churn and improve network performance.
